A wonderful combination is coming to Fuquay Varina this weekend. Defining Design is welcoming Pineville Rug Galleries fine oriental rug tent show complete with design workshops on both Friday and Saturday, exclusive rug designs, great food and partial proceeds are going to support the Triangle American Red Cross.

“We are banding together in the face of difficult times. It is just one great charateristic of our country. No organization does this better than the American Red Cross,” Carol Adcock, partial owner of Defining Design said. “With the onset of hurricane season we felt that as we invite our clients, friends and neighbors to this exciting event, we also ask that you open your heart this wonderful organization.”

This semi annual event brings exclusive designs, sizes and styles together under one very large tent.

There will be two informative workshops. On April 26 at 2 p.m., check out the “Advanced Oriental Rug Workshop” and on April 27 at 1 p.m., there will be a class for everyone that ever wanted to learn about the art of this craft, “Oriental Rug 101.”

On hand to answer questions will be the owner of Pineville Rug Galleries, who brings many years of expertise to assist designers, buyers and all those that have a curiosity.

Defining Design is located on the grounds of Adcock Nursery and is a premier interior design house. Locally owned by Carol Adcock and Mishi McCoy, they specialize in all areas of design with a flair for landscaping architectural plans.

This premier event promises to be educational as well as two days of fun with partial supporting going to our own local Triangle American Red Cross. For more information, please call 919-552-9930.

The Fuquay-Varina Woman’s Club Public Issues Community Service Program collected items for the SPCA of Wake County from the club members. The group made a delivery Jan. 28 that included eight bottles of bleach, 10 boxes of dog treats, one large container of small dog treats, various small packages of dog treats, paper towels, seven cans of canned dog food, Kitten Chow and a $25 donation.  Darci VanderSlik accepted the donations along with one of the puppies for adoption.
